This is ridiculous.  Borland has been making DOS compilers longer than they
have been making OS/2 compilers, so the version numbers differ.  The latest
BC++ 2.0 for OS/2 was released after BC++ 4.0 for DOS and uses the same
basic compiler.  Although the OS/2 version lags the DOS version, it does
not lag it as much as you seem to think.
